打开Visual Studio 并创建项目。 如果“开始”窗口尚未打开,请选择“文件 > 启动窗口”。在“开始”窗口中,选择创建新项目。 在搜索框中,键入“空项目”,然后选择C++空项目模板。 如果未看到项目模板,请打开Visual Studio 安装程序。 选择具有C++工作负载的桌面开发,然后选择“修改”。
打个断点,直接运行debug,可以让编辑器自己去创建 lanch.json 和 task.json 配置文件 这里选择C++(GDB/LLDB)、不要用C++(windows),debug运行的是 windows 自带的 cmd 下一步 选择 g++.exe 如下截图; 记住不要用 C++(WIndows) 选项的话,会调用的是操作系统的cmd运行去运行程序,无法在vscode中正常debug,尝试了一...
若要设置 Visual Studio 以进行 .NET 调试,首先需要一个 .NET 项目。 Visual Studio 提供了许多初学者模板,使创建新项目变得容易。 在Visual Studio 中,选择“文件”、“新建”>、“项目”。 在“创建新项目”对话框中,选择“控制台应用”,然后选择“下一步”。 将项目命名为 DotNetDebugging,然后选择要保...
Debug 通常称为调试版本,它包含调试信息,并且不作任何优化,便于程序员调试程序。 在Debug模式下调试,可以在断点处看到详细的调试提示信息,如下图: 并且在输出目录中生成 Debug 目录及可运行文件: 调试前请将【解决方案配置】设置为 Debug 模式。如果设置为 Release 模式,Visual Studio 项目具有针对你的程序的单独发布...
在Visual Studio一般默认有四种编译方式: Debug, MinSizeRel, Release, RelWithDebInfo. RelWithDebInfo模式在保留Release模式下运行快速的前提下,又可以给特定的工程开启Debug模式,进行针对性的调试。这样比整个项目都采用Debug模式进行编译,在调试时会提高效率。
vscode windows 端 debug 配置 windows 端编译运行C/C++的程序需要一套集成开发环境,这里可以使用 MinGW https://nuwen.net/mingw.html ,选择自己需要的安装包安装即可,我就直接用推荐的。 window MinGW 环境安装 下载MinGW的安装包,安装即可(当然如果电脑上装着 Visual Studio,也可以用它的工具集配置环境)。
断点,可以说是 Debug 过程中最常用的功能。 但是大家最熟悉最经常使用的可能就是普通的断点。其实,关于断点,Visual Studio 有很多的高级功能,有些简直就是调试利器啊。 本次教程将介绍 Visual Studio 关于断点的更多高级玩法。 1. 普通断点 为了保证内容完整性,还是要说下普通断点。 设置普通断点的方法很简单,就是...
vscode windows 端 debug 配置 windows 端编译运行C/C++的程序需要一套集成开发环境,这里可以使用 MinGWhttps://nuwen.net/mingw.html,选择自己需要的安装包安装即可,我就直接用推荐的。 window MinGW 环境安装 下载MinGW的安装包,安装即可(当然如果电脑上装着 Visual Studio,也可以用它的工具集配置环境)。
固定的数据提示在调试会话中保留,Visual Studio 重启。 可以从断点窗口标记断点,或者通过右键单击断点来标记断点。 通过标签,可以更轻松地组织断点并将其导出到 XML 文件。 可以将代码表达式从 Visual Studio 编辑器拖放或复制粘贴到监视窗口以浏览其值和属性。 此功能适用于多个监视窗口。 可以将断点从一个位置拖放...
Visual Studio 的最新版本和历史版本 用于开发/测试目的时的 Azure 服务折扣 用于支持开发工作流的 DevOps 服务 用于学习、试验和制作原型的每月 Azure 额度 访问Microsoft 的整个软件目录以供开发/测试使用 培训资源,如 Pluralsight 和 LinkedIn Learning 适用于开发/测试问题的技术支持事件 ...